Education Commissioner Leads Condolence Visit to Andoma of Doma Over Daughter’s Demise

By Suleiman Abubakar

The Nasarawa State Commissioner for Education, Dr. John D. W. Mamman, has led a delegation of senior officials from the Ministry of Education to the palace of the Andoma of Doma, His Royal Highness Alhaji Ahmadu Aliyu Oga Onawo, to commiserate with him over the death of his daughter, Barrister Binta Aliyu Oga.



Accompanied by the Permanent Secretary and Directors from the Ministry, Dr. Mamman conveyed the heartfelt condolences of the education sector to the grieving monarch and his family.

He described the late Barrister Binta as a distinguished and promising woman whose untimely death has left a vacuum in the hearts of many.

“The entire education family in Nasarawa State mourns with Your Highness.

We stand in solidarity with you during this painful moment and pray that Almighty Allah grants her eternal rest and gives the family the strength to bear this loss,” Dr. Mamman said.

The condolence visit highlighted the ministry’s respect for traditional institutions and its commitment to sharing in the joys and sorrows of the communities it serves.
